Pakistan: Independents appear to be ahead in parliamentary elections. Massive internet shutdowns have overshadowed the elections in Pakistan.

There is still no clear result - but there is a surprising trend. Around 130 million eligible voters were called on Thursday in the nuclear power to vote on the distribution of power in the National Assembly and the provincial parliaments. The PML-N of three-time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if, who was recently considered the favorite, was in second place with a good 30 percent.
